We are looking for a highly organised and proactive Office admin to support the smooth running of our company operations. The ideal candidate will be confident, detail-oriented, and able to juggle mult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ment. You’ll play a vital role in keeping our projects and people on track by ordering materials, updating internal systems, and maintaining essential admin processes.
Key Responsibilities
- Maintaining and distributing weekly order lists
- Gathering sustainability data and helping to report it
- General office admin: distributing post, handling returns, restocking stationery
- Answering incoming phone calls and assisting with enquiries
- Coordinating company socials and internal events
- Asset admin and logging
- Filing delivery notes
- Organising couriers
- Ordering workshop materials / stock
- Assisting new employee onboarding
